What does it look like to live with compassion and hope in the midst of suffering? In this episode, actor and producer DeVon Franklin joins us to discuss his role in the upcoming film Soul on Fire, which tells the incredible true story of John O’Leary—a boy who survived burns on 100% of his body and went on to become a bestselling author and motivational speaker.
Franklin shares why he was drawn to this project, how he prepared to portray the real-life hero Nurse Roy, and what audiences can take away from John’s story of resilience, faith, and community. He also opens up about his filmmaking journey, the importance of hope-driven content, and his upcoming Netflix project Ruth and Boaz.
